1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-10-20 19:42:54 +02:00
llvm-mirror/lib
Dan Gohman 7a9e8cbf79 I was convinced that it's ok to allow a second i8 return value
to be returned in DL. LLVM's multiple-return-value support is
not ABI-conforming; front-ends that wish to have code emitted
that conforms to an ABI are currently expected to make
arrangements for this on their own rather than assuming that
multiple-return-values will automatically do the right thing.
This commit doesn't fundamentally change this situation.

llvm-svn: 67588
2009-03-24 01:04:34 +00:00
..
Analysis LoopVR is not CFGOnly. 2009-03-23 15:50:52 +00:00
Archive Add the private linkage. 2009-01-15 20:18:42 +00:00
AsmParser Fix internal representation of fp80 to be the 2009-03-23 21:16:53 +00:00
Bitcode Fix internal representation of fp80 to be the 2009-03-23 21:16:53 +00:00
CodeGen Minor compile-time optimization; don't bother checking 2009-03-24 00:50:07 +00:00
CompilerDriver Reorganize llvmc code. 2009-03-02 09:01:14 +00:00
Debugger Oops...I committed too much. 2009-03-13 04:39:26 +00:00
ExecutionEngine Fix some significant problems with constant pools that resulted in unnecessary paddings between constant pool entries, larger than necessary alignments (e.g. 8 byte alignment for .literal4 sections), and potentially other issues. 2009-03-13 07:51:59 +00:00
Linker Apply ODR linkage changes accidentally dropped during 2009-03-08 13:35:23 +00:00
Support Fix internal representation of fp80 to be the 2009-03-23 21:16:53 +00:00
System fix a bug Alexei Svitkine pointed out. 2009-03-23 06:46:20 +00:00
Target I was convinced that it's ok to allow a second i8 return value 2009-03-24 01:04:34 +00:00
Transforms Use a SmallPtrSet instead of std::set. 2009-03-23 23:39:20 +00:00
VMCore Fix internal representation of fp80 to be the 2009-03-23 21:16:53 +00:00
Makefile Reorganize llvmc code. 2009-03-02 09:01:14 +00:00